Hi guys,

I did a fresh install of CCM4.2(3) on an MCS 7835-H2 with 1GB RAM and dual 18.2GB hard drives. The problem is that the CCM service keeps stopping. I get the following message in event viewer:

"The Cisco CallManager service terminated unexpectedly. It has done this 1 times(s). The following corrective action will be taken in 60000 milliseconds: Restart the service."

The only thing I can think of is that maybe I don't have enough RAM.

Any ideas guys?

Hi Kane,

Even , I faced the Same Issue and Error at the time of fresh installation. After I put the CCM Server in the LAN, then I restarted the CCM(pub) Server, the CCM Service started working fine.

Then I identified that we need to put the CCM in LAN, at the time of installation and restart.

I think you can try the same for troubleshooting.
